CATALOGUE DESCRIPTION
A sketch of four heads, three of which are distinctly feminine. Three figures wear hats; the other figure's hair is done up and she also wears a red collar and lipstick. The three figures in the foreground are looking out toward the viewer and the one in the background seen in profile, looking down to the left of the image.
